Spider twenty twenty-five sizing: How do pieces really run?
Hoodies are boxy with dropped shoulders; tees are true-to-size with a relaxed drape; track pants sit true in the midsection with ease in the leg. If you want a classic streetwear profile, go standard; if you prefer snug, size down one. Women typically convert by dropping down one from their normal women’s size to men’s/unisex.
For hoodies, expect generous body width and a moderately abbreviated-to-normal length that stacks well over tees. If your focus is arm length and total length, stay with standard sizing; if your priority is a tighter, more fitted profile, size down one. Tees use a heavier cotton than standard basics, so they hang away from the frame without clinging; most buyers stay true-to-size unless they explicitly seek a skate-style oversized aesthetic. Track pants feature an elastic waistband with a drawcord and are cut roomy through the thigh; taller buyers should check listed inner seam on the listing because leg measurements can differ by collection. Always verify with the garment measurements when available and compare to a pullover or t-shirt you currently own by measuring chest width and top-to-bottom.
What size should you choose if you fall between sizes?
Body or waist specs spanning two choices require spider hoodie official website length-based choices. Sizing up provides extra body and sleeve length reach; sizing down creates cleaner, shortened drape.
Sp5der’s boxy blocks mean chest width usually isn’t the issue—measurements matters most. For hoodies, a bigger option nets you additional sleeve reach and body length without becoming tight in the shoulder area. For tees, sizing down sharpens the shoulder seam and reduces sleeve extension while preserving enough chest room for mobility. For track pants, focus on waist comfort first, then confirm outseam or inner measurements because cuff-to-floor stacking is where issues develops.

How do you authenticate a Sp5der piece without guesswork?
Deploy a comprehensive verification approach: graphic correctness, print technique and surface quality, rhinestone arrangement (when applicable), collar and maintenance markings, stitching standards, material weight and movement, and documentation. Individual verifications create risk; compile three or more strong confirmations.
Start validation with artwork assessment. Verify the specific design components, placement, and sizing against legitimate brand visuals from brand and trusted retail channels; replica producers frequently invent fake colorways or wrongly locate web graphics relative to chest structural elements. Assess artwork properties: authentic puff graphics exhibits uniform elevation with defined edges and matte-to-satin appearances, versus rubbery finishes with material accumulation at edge areas. For rhinestone usage, elements must maintain regular grid or circular arrangements with minimal adhesive presence; inconsistent gaps or apparent hazy bonding evidence signal replica production. Advance to internal manufacturing review: proper serged stitching featuring consistent thread tension and neat seam conclusions indicates professional manufacturing standards, while dangling seam elements, inconsistent stitching density or fabric puckering suggest replica manufacturing. Complete with label and care tag analysis for fine manufacturing quality, accurate font kerning and correct washing text copy; spelling errors and fuzzy weaving quality constitute typical counterfeit indicators.
Checkpoint | Authentic | Common Fake |
---|---|---|
Graphic placement | Centered, consistent scale; web graphics coordinate across seams | Incorrectly positioned, scaled or shrunken motifs; misaligned webs |
Lettering and the “5” | Clean, consistent kerning; the “5” has a specific proportion | Irregular kerning; “5” too thin/thick; distorted proportions |
Dimensional print texture | Even height, matte/satin finish, sharp boundaries | Shiny, poor quality, builds up at corners; boundaries smudge or bleed |
Rhinestones (if any) | Uniform pattern, limited glue visible | Random gaps, crooked lines, unclear bonding residue |
Label/washing tags | Quality manufacturing, clean typography, correct copy | Substandard manufacturing, variable lettering, typos or off grammar |
Interior seam work | Straight overlock, consistent tension, tidy bar-tacks | Loose threads, bunching, uneven seam density |
Fabric and drape | Substantial cotton with soft hand, natural drape | Stiff, cardboard feel or unusually thin body |
Smell and finish | Neutral textile scent, quality construction | Strong synthetic smell, plasticizer odor, rough edges |
Cost and seller trail | Aligned with standard values; confirmed provenance | Unrealistically discounted, fresh profiles, borrowed pictures only |

Pricing bands and color variant logic
Retail pricing sits in expected ranges: hoodies typically sit in the low- to middle hundreds, tees in the mid-range to low hundreds, and track pants approximately the low- to mid-hundreds depending on fabrication and details. If a fresh hoodie is offered far below those ranges from an questionable source, assume counterfeit until verified otherwise.
Limited color variants incorporating complex print work or rhinestone components drive higher standard costs and enhanced aftermarket premium performance, while staple colors like black, grey, and navy stay consistent with standard pricing after initial demand stabilizes. Partnership and event-specific color options can separate from standard cost structures and experience significant movement, especially in popular measurement options. Always cross-reference across diverse marketplace venues to determine real transaction values as opposed to posted values that frequently reflect inflated seller expectations. If costs appears 40–60% beneath market benchmarks while sellers refuse thorough image proof, the circumstance indicates scam behavior not genuine deals.
